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Diệt truy vấn MySQL trong khi thực thi với PHP và AJAX

Trước hết, nếu mục đích của truy vấn chỉ là để kiểm tra cú pháp, đừng thực thi nó! thực thi giải thích hoặc thêm giới hạn 0 hoặc thực thi trên cơ sở dữ liệu trống.

Đối với việc giết chết, bạn phải kết nối với cơ sở dữ liệu bằng quyền root và ra lệnh KILL (nhưng bạn cần biết id truy vấn). Hoặc bạn có thể giết toàn bộ luồng. Hãy xem mysqli ::kill

Chỉnh sửa:có vẻ như bạn không cần đặc quyền root, để xem các truy vấn của người dùng của bạn, hãy sử dụng lệnh SHOW PROCESSLIST



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Hiển thị thông báo lỗi SQL

  2. Cách tốt nhất để kiểm tra xem mysql_query có trả lại kết quả nào không?

  3. tìm kiếm các sản phẩm mà khách hàng đã mua cùng nhau

  4. Bí danh MySQL cho các cột SELECT *

  5. Khởi động lại giao dịch trong MySQL sau khi bế tắc